Assumptions

  • Trapezoid alternate depths: E = y + Q²/(2g A²) with A=(b+z y)y; both y_sub>yc and y_super<yc at the same E, Q, b, z; SI; default g=9.80665; z>0 is run/rise
  • Unknown is the pair (depths mode) or E (energy invert from one y); E>Ec=yc+D_c/2; Fr is reported not an input
  • Not rectangular alternate depth; not trapezoid E from y+Q; not trapezoid yc as the product; not trapezoid yn; not Manning n; not Q=Av
